In healthcare lack of mobile signal is not merely an inconvenience, it affects patient experience and operational continuity. At Midland Metropolitan University Hospital, Freshwave’s distributed antenna system (DAS) ensures everyone, no matter which cellular network they’re on, can use their mobile phones with no issues.
